The Department of Defense, through the Naval Air Systems Command (NAVAIR), intends to award an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ract for sealant removal and replacement services on E-6B aircraft. The contract will specifically involve the removal of EF-5992 sealant and its reapplication on fuel cells and surfaces of nine E-6B aircraft, with performance expected at Tinker Air Force Base in Oklahoma during depot maintenance events from Fiscal Year 2025 through 2029, including options for two additional years. This procurement is critical as it ensures the integrity and safety of the aircraft, with Performance Aircraft Systems, Inc. being the sole source due to their unique capability to perform the work without damaging the aircraft structures.
